본문 바로가기

내일배움캠프149

[TIL] 내일배움캠프 React 과정 2022.11.04 Today I Learned 팀프로젝트 발표 팀프로젝트 KPT 회고 작성 느낀 점 오늘은 5일 동안 팀원들과 열심히 준비한 팀프로젝트의 발표가 있는 날이었다. 우리 팀의 발표로 인한 긴장감과 다른 팀들은 어떤 웹페이지를 만들었을까 설레는 마음을 가지고 발표가 시작됐는데 첫 조부터 엄청난 실력에 충격을 받았다. 그리고 다른 팀들의 발표가 계속될수록 원래도 없던 자신감이 뚝뚝 떨어지기 시작했다. 나는 이번 프로젝트를 진행하면서 노베이스 상태로 웹개발 종합반 강의 하나만 듣고 이 정도 결과물이라면 완벽하진 않더라도 나름 만족한다고 생각했었는데 다른 분들에 비하면 내 수준은 아직 바닥에 있는 거 같다. 만약 저렇게 엄청난 실력자 분들과 팀이 된다면 그 실력을 어떻게 따라잡아야 할지 걱정이 되기도 했다. 하지막 .. 2022. 11. 5.
내일배움캠프 React B반 8조 팀프로젝트 KPT 회고 React B반 8조 팀원: 김명준, 김원준, 고현석, 남마리나, 이희령 팀명: let 리액트 천재 프로젝트명: 코딩하고 레벨 업 Keep 처음에 프로젝트를 기획하면서 세부적으로 역할을 분담하여서 효율적으로 진행할 수 있었다. 기능 구현이 안되거나 막히는 부분이 생기더라도 포기하지 않고 팀원들이 협력하여 해결하기 위해 끝까지 노력했다. 중간중간 피드백을 주고받으면서 진행 상황을 보고하고 부족한 부분은 수정하는 방식으로 프로젝트를 진행했다. Problem 팀원들이 모두 github 사용에 미숙해서 어려움을 겪었다. 코드 작성 규칙을 먼저 정했다면 각 페이지를 통합하는 과정에서 수월했을 거 같다. 초반 기획 단계에서 레이아웃을 더욱 구체적으로 설정하지 않은 점이 아쉽다. 백엔드 부분을 한 명이 맡아서 진행했.. 2022. 11. 4.
[TIL] 내일배움캠프 React 과정 2022.11.03 Today I Learned 개인 페이지 최종 완성 모든 페이지 통합하여 연결 리액트 튜터님과 개인 상담 발표 자료 만들기(ppt&대본) 🎉드디어 개인 페이지 완성🎉 어려웠던 부분 링크 클릭할 때 마우스 커서 모양 변경 버튼을 클릭했을 때 각 팀원의 페이지나 블로그로 이동하도록 링크를 성절해 놓았는데 마우스커서를 손 모양으로 변경해서 페이지를 이동할 수 있다는 것을 더욱 명시적으로 보여주고 싶었다. 방법은 굉장히 간단해서 해당 CSS 에 cursor: pointer;를 추가했다. github 활용하기 팀프로젝트 완성이 우선이라고 생각해서 아직 git bash 사용방법은 익히지 못하고 github 사이트에서 직접 파일을 올리거나 수정하고 있다. 그래서 git pull 기능도 못쓰고 있어서 커밋될 때마다 코.. 2022. 11. 3.
[TIL] 내일배움캠프 React 과정 2022.11.02 Today I Learned 미니 프로젝트 개인 페이지 완성 github 특강 복습 후 github 연동 시도(에 그침..) 발표 자료 초안 작성 저녁 먹고 잠시 비어나잇🍺 어려웠던 부분 이미지 위치 고정 내 소개 박스 안에서 이미지를 글의 길이와 상관없이 하단에 고정되도록 하고 싶어서 구글링을 했다. .tab-content{ position: relative; width: 640px; height: 380px; text-align: center; margin-top: 20px; line-height: 200%; } .text-image{ position: absolute; bottom: 10px; right: 10px; height: 220px; width: 600px; } 해결 방법은 부모 요소에 p.. 2022. 11. 2.
[TIL] 내일배움캠프 React 과정 2022.11.01 Today I Learned 매니저님과 개인 상담 미니 프로젝트 개인 페이지 구현 어려웠던 부분 어제저녁부터 방명록 남기는 기능을 구현하기 위한 python 파일에서 라는 경고 메시지가 떴다. 그래서 방명록 댓글이 mongoDB에 저장되지 않는 이유가 python과 html 파일이 아예 연결되지 않았기 때문이라고 생각해서 구글링도 해보았지만 혼자 힘으로는 해결할 수 없었다. 그래서 매니저님과 상담할 때도 여쭤보고 리액트 튜터님께도 여쭤봤지만 시간이 부족해서 문제를 해결하지는 못했다. 하지만 그분들에게서 에러를 해결하는 방법에 대해서는 배울 수 있었다. 구글 console창을 확인해본다거나 너무 한 가지 문제에만 집착하지 말고 시야를 넓혀서 코드를 전체적으로 살펴보는 방법까지. 면담 후에 app.py와 i.. 2022. 11. 1.
[TIL] 내일배움캠프 React 과정 2022.10.31 Today I Learned 미니프로젝트 발제-S.A 작성 GIT 협업 특강 GIT 작업 디렉터리: 버전 관리의 대상이 위치하는 공간 (.git이 위치함) 스테이지: 다음 버전이 될 후보가 올라가는 공간 저장소: 버전이 만들어지고 관리되는 공간 버전: 유의미한 변화가 결과물로 나온 것 GIT 명령어 정리 git init: 비어있는 로컬 저장소 생성 git status: 작업 디렉터리 상태 확인하기 git add: 변경사항스테이지에 올리기 git commit: 커밋 메세지와 함께 커밋하기 git log: 만들어진 버전 확인 원격 저장소와의 상호작용 git clone: 원격 저장소를 내 컴퓨터로 복제하기 git push: 원격 저장소에 코럴 저장소의 변경사항을 올리기 git pull: 원격 저장소를 내 컴퓨.. 2022. 10. 31.
내일배움캠프 React B반 8조 미니 팀프로젝트 S.A 프로젝트 설명 팀명: let 리액트 천재 프로젝트명: 코딩하고 레벨 업 우리 팀과 팀원들을 소개할 수 있는 웹페이지를 만든다. 팀원 소개 내용으로는 다음 항목을 포함한다. 1. [팀]과 [자신]에 대한 설명 및 MBTI 2. 객관적으로 살펴본 자신의 장점 3. 협업을 하는 과정에서의 자신의 스타일 4. 우리 팀만의 색깔과 표현하고 싶은 시각적 스타일 5. 우리 팀의 약속 6. 팀원들의 블로그 주소 와이어프레임 API 설계 기능 Method URL request response 방명록 전체보기 GET /api/comment 방명록 작성 POST /api/comment {'name':name, 'contents':contents} 2022. 10. 31.
부트캠프를 위해 준비한 것과 준비하지 못한 것 10월 31일에 내일배움캠프가 개강한다. 4달 동안 9 to 9 일정을 소화하기 위해 내가 준비한 것들을 기록해보려 한다! 📌부트캠프를 위해 준비한 것 1. 웹캠 구매하기 내 노트북은 5년 이상 사용한 LG그램 구형 모델이기 때문에 카메라가 하단에 달려있다. 그래서 눈높이가 안 맞는 느낌이라 항상 불만을 가지고 있었기 때문에 이번 기회에 웹캠을 하나 샀다. 근데 배송 오고 카메라 테스트를 해봤는데 화질이 너무 좋아서 부담스럽다. 웹캠은 차라리 화질이 안 좋았으면 좋겠다ㅋㅋ 2. 병원 다녀오기 평일 저녁 9시까지 온라인으로 수업을 들어야 하기 때문에 병원을 미리 다녀왔다. 인공눈물이 필수인 사람이라 안과에 가서 인공눈물을 처방받아 왔는데 4만 원이나 나와서 깜짝 놀랐다.😦 3. 노트북 배터리 교체하기 갑자.. 2022. 10. 31.
스파르타코딩클럽 내일배움캠프 4기 React 프론트엔트 과정에 합류하다 취업을 위해 본격적으로 코딩을 배우고 싶다는 생각에 국비지원 과정을 알아보았다. 서울까지 왔다 갔다 하기에는 체력적으로 힘들 거 같아서 온라인 부트캠프 위주로 검색했고 결과적으로 스파르타코딩클럽의 내일배움캠프를 선택했다. 부트캠프 관련 정보는 아래 사이트를 추천한다. https://boottent.sayun.studio/camps 내일배움캠프를 선택한 이유 1년 전에 스파르타코딩클럽에서 무료 강의를 몇 번 들었었는데 코딩을 쉽고 재밌게 가르쳐 주길래 호감을 가지고 있었고 이것도 내배캠을 선택한 이유 중에 하나였다. 가장 걱정했던 건 9to9이라는 수업 시간이었다. 저녁 9시까지 체력적으로 버틸 수 있을지 고민이 되어서 일단 부트캠프 국비지원과는 별개로 웹개발 종합반과 앱개발 종합반 강의를 신청해서 수강했.. 2022. 10. 27.